Received: by 2002:a05:6358:3188:b0:123:57c1:9b43 with SMTP id q8csp2885048rwd; Fri, 26 May 2023 12:48:53 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49Mmh8GJ5RiS1dDIr+N9uFgZ+Pls/VBnR8NjZbimUWv741Q0NzyZS8UNOz4eqkJ5nkVPQx X-Received: by 2002:a17:90a:f417:b0:256:2fd4:e239 with SMTP id ch23-20020a17090af41700b002562fd4e239mr3184429pjb.23.1685130533383; Fri, 26 May 2023 12:48:53 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1685130533; cv=none; d=google.com; s=arc-20160816; b=Ldq744GTtBNAT1QPM3S+o4tiDbmJOqu8gPSXX2uJSpowoBcosR1etf5YEGFC5sF5Ib QKbMzemhzxhGiM8KqXnk6VFzt+8w7vy56EYv06HAE5/xslWS6ICYXf3xfKDnYwN8UKMS X/JdnU8euLncj/QlgncbV76RtYqbhYuWeuvn7q8qta7cb4D4GC9ktvqxzuj0fi8MVjBR EGPuslbxvfMTbVxLy88NfpAB5Zjp8A70yooieNMOBcPzsUTut0e/Cl8+kZ6kbLov2pkf 9SWemF2jK6qZebXKi54Vrsc3KmUw3VVk8njT5hliKB9YxOblTq6U3NJGZKE/96TXA42U AQqQ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:in-reply-to :organization:from:references:cc:to:content-language:subject :user-agent:mime-version:date:message-id:dkim-signature; bh=AQbvDzRrNGGmJC0cFwixRt7YyXto2u7DcheHfHIL6TM=; b=xtF58MFdZilil6O2pDySNAnkTVamw/+3WzLDob50yXb359ighdSOLkDCHAUGV3WTjg aeGDfKQ57zQHWZwgV6H8r917t4Ailujn44aUkn4S9mWpdpq7PqUkGo8UUQ9CSwWob9of UBpPyqN4ZsXnS0q2hA6zzQ3D6hIwM78vklCKrvj18+k5brNEoz0gaKOGQWu6/MTlOT1Y gEnVzuAgRUxeubvpDwUPENttD97Mqr6wUqdag8H/FR9cMtat3gB0ohFfPoXLYFlhrkKT wBN0LsKmFFLvTovI/ETK5VDozFmYza7DqCYZkYMTBIAJ2Vxm5KVHeN7aVQ1ZJJmI1Smr FeKQ==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@redhat.com header.s=mimecast20190719 header.b=OYsU0+Oj;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=redhat.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id 11-20020a17090a198b00b00253160141c7si1659873pji.83.2023.05.26.12.48.38; Fri, 26 May 2023 12:48:53 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@redhat.com header.s=mimecast20190719 header.b=OYsU0+Oj;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=redhat.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S237707AbjEZTmu (ORCPT + 99 others); Fri, 26 May 2023 15:42:50 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:56810 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S237094AbjEZTmr (ORCPT ); Fri, 26 May 2023 15:42:47 -0400 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.129.124]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 933E7FB for ; Fri, 26 May 2023 12:42:05 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1685130124;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references; bh=AQbvDzRrNGGmJC0cFwixRt7YyXto2u7DcheHfHIL6TM=; b=OYsU0+OjhamxJKamSgkSp/7bkjbZqPzBIg9R6Aqza2jiaiD5hJumOxDDsBEqZQzhGbyV4e lD2TkJtptNBJo+/U1HIsJdTcRRX5JYrT4wf6kpsnVy7vA3GmDao3N/FZ32A5OTNS/SPEMw xTlGRvZQSfjazl9IDak81+1foULFboM= Received: from mail-wm1-f72.google.com (mail-wm1-f72.google.com [209.85.128.72]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-171-ENhkZAlEO86Y4ZQC1axtjg-1; Fri, 26 May 2023 15:42:03 -0400 X-MC-Unique: ENhkZAlEO86Y4ZQC1axtjg-1 Received: by mail-wm1-f72.google.com with SMTP id 5b1f17b1804b1-3f6eb8d3848so3855255e9.1 for ; Fri, 26 May 2023 12:42:03 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1685130122; x=1687722122; h=content-transfer-encoding:in-reply-to:organization:from:references :cc:to:content-language:subject:user-agent:mime-version:date :message-id:x-gm-message-state:from:to:cc:subject:date:message-id :reply-to; bh=AQbvDzRrNGGmJC0cFwixRt7YyXto2u7DcheHfHIL6TM=; b=mDYwsGtzb+EXmSU6M4K3BbBbef8xANr4C2wUl5TYexXTwEzzzk3dFYreMWX/14Ypqi 8rVC4tkbRd9TuTmnQAN9XIm4HK2fYzOizNm+z6oc3G7z8Jh14Q1apfeDItXGC7SKmIDE CyZenO1CW7e579JOOcw46iJDaAJ63gA1gkDEfa71K1VpEpbag2MXEFv97NFW3T+Vb4W5 r5pjoN4OUCd53yiM+Xx6Y+w6Z18C0HM1gym7Bx5GlQPeZX+WG+nGd+TazXl62gpji/F2 RbFOWIg8vh2AYb6cvE3CYKjk3WT74n9ZiSbq5/O783/AsBOf8ILnju0OYdLjd5FUMfDg bJ8g== X-Gm-Message-State: AC+VfDzMm+p2uptT2691k05nFT/pu9y654jQZsx+o/sjA8tV5UNeyYkJ OSrhUe7GbyAItgfwPRri1LtQVZmvU2SwJUgr6HWU1/SKCHwKU+HvymqibgMn9tQNJSgy9a/X511 +b6t1Pww2wjfl63AAM04O4eOH X-Received: by 2002:a1c:7407:0:b0:3f6:cfc7:8bce with SMTP id p7-20020a1c7407000000b003f6cfc78bcemr2507518wmc.22.1685130122171; Fri, 26 May 2023 12:42:02 -0700 (PDT) X-Received: by 2002:a1c:7407:0:b0:3f6:cfc7:8bce with SMTP id p7-20020a1c7407000000b003f6cfc78bcemr2507506wmc.22.1685130121842; Fri, 26 May 2023 12:42:01 -0700 (PDT) Received: from ?IPV6:2003:d8:2f2e:ae00:f2e3:50e0:73f7:451? (p200300d82f2eae00f2e350e073f70451.dip0.t-ipconnect.de. [2003:d8:2f2e:ae00:f2e3:50e0:73f7:451]) by smtp.gmail.com with ESMTPSA id 8-20020a05600c024800b003f4e8530696sm6035997wmj.46.2023.05.26.12.42.00 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Fri, 26 May 2023 12:42:01 -0700 (PDT) Message-ID: Date: Fri, 26 May 2023 21:42:00 +0200 MIME-Version: 1.0 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Thunderbird/102.10.0 Subject: Re: [PATCH] mm/gup_test:fix ioctl fail for compat task Content-Language: en-US To: Haibo Li , linux-kernel@vger.kernel.org Cc: Andrew Morton , Matthias Brugger , AngeloGioacchino Del Regno , linux-mm@kvack.org, linux-arm-kernel@lists.infradead.org, linux-mediatek@lists.infradead.org, xiaoming.yu@mediatek.com References: <20230526022125.175728-1-haibo.li@mediatek.com> From: David Hildenbrand Organization: Red Hat In-Reply-To: <20230526022125.175728-1-haibo.li@mediatek.com>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it X-Spam-Status: No, score=-2.2 required=5.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,NICE_REPLY_A, R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_NONE,T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 26.05.23 04:21, Haibo Li wrote: Nit: "mm/gup_test: fix ioctl fail for compat task" > When tools/testing/selftests/mm/gup_test.c is compiled as 32bit, > then run on arm64 kernel, > it reports "ioctl: Inappropriate ioctl for device". > > Fix it by filling compat_ioctl in gup_test_fops > > Signed-off-by: Haibo Li > --- > mm/gup_test.c | 1 + > 1 file changed, 1 insertion(+) > > diff --git a/mm/gup_test.c b/mm/gup_test.c > index 8ae7307a1bb6..c0421b786dcd 100644 > --- a/mm/gup_test.c > +++ b/mm/gup_test.c > @@ -381,6 +381,7 @@ static int gup_test_release(struct inode *inode, struct file *file) > static const struct file_operations gup_test_fops = { > .open = nonseekable_open, > .unlocked_ioctl = gup_test_ioctl, > + .compat_ioctl = compat_ptr_ioctl, > .release = gup_test_release, > }; > Acked-by: David Hildenbrand -- Thanks, David / dhildenb